In general, a privacy policy appears to be a written document regarding conditions and regulations involving the so-called relationship between you and a website you use. Definitely, there are no any standards or requirements this document may rely on though a privacy policy has to contain certain important points. Firstly, these documents are to be understandable and flexible. They should contain simple words clear for the people who use the website. A privacy policy has to outline what personal information the website collects in particular. For example, this may involve e-mail addresses, phone numbers, and addresses. Everything depends on the goals a website tries to achieve. Some websites may also offer various surveys. And this also involves additional information. Even better if there is practice of creating the list of necessary information (such as IP address) and the additional (such as home address).
In most privacy policy documents the purpose of the used data is described. In other words, if a website requires any details it should be clarified what these details are used for. Maybe, a website’s owners share this information with other companies for marketing purposes. But in case you don’t want any advertisements to appear in the future then just be attentive before giving websites any personal information.
On the other hand, some personal facts may be even necessary when talking about shipments or payments. If you pay your bills with a credit card, the information will be available for workers of a bank. The same story is with purchasing goods because here you have to type the address and phone number. Moreover, such websites should contain an option of changing the information. As once you submit certain data you are to have an opportunity of making changes.
Any website privacy policy has to contain the terms of regulations. To be more exact, how will you learn about the appearance of new features? Like any document, a privacy policy is a living notion. There changes can occur at all times - and as a website owner it can be a good idea to contact a lawyer or doing some background research on Media Law before ammending yours.
And finally, the most important thing is the contact information of a website owner. Any legal document contains the personal information of the both parts. Make sure a privacy policy of the chosen website has the e-mails or phone numbers of its creators. So as you can contact them anytime you have questions about a privacy policy.
